She and her parents were born on Long Island.
Susan had been married previously to James H. Kolyer (b.c. 1824, died bef 1875?), and had at least three sons and a daughter by him:
- John Morrell (1846-1915)
- James H. (1848-1917?)
- Eliza Jane (1849, d bef 1888?)
- Fletcher H. (c1854-1933)
Fletcher and perhaps James may have been named after some of the Harper brothers of publishing fame, as the mother of those brothers was an Elizabeth Kolyer, and perhaps a great aunt to their father.
Eliza Jane is not mentioned in her mother's will. The will also states that Susan had no descendants of deceased children. An Eliza Jane Calyer had a girl with John Hultz in Brooklyn in 1867. Not sure if this is her.
